Labrador Retrievers are classified as sporting dogs. They are a breed of retriever-gun dogs that originated in the Newfoundland region and were bred for retrieving game during hunting. These dogs have been bred for their loyalty, strong work ethic, and excellent swimming ability. Labrador Retrievers are known for their intelligence, even temperaments, and extraordinary trainability; which makes them incredibly popular in search and rescue and other rescue missions. They are also a great family pet due to their outgoing, friendly personalities.
Labrador Retrievers are not non-shedding, but have their own unique coat that sets them apart from other breeds. This coat has a protective, water-repellant outer coat with a soft, downy undercoat. While Labradors do shed, their shedding is usually very easy to manage when groomed and brushed regularly. The amount of shedding varies from dog to dog, depending on their level of activity, nutrition, and genetics. It's important to understand that Labradors do have a coat that requires gentle grooming to reduce the amount of shedding and to maintain its appearance.
Labrador Retrievers typically have a diet that consists of high-quality dry dog food specifically designed for large breed dogs. It is best to avoid any food that is high in carbohydrates and fillers. Additionally, these loyal and highly intelligent canines should have access to supplemental nutritious foods such as lean meat, fish, and eggs. Moreover, it is wise to offer some variety by adding fresh fruits and vegetables into their diet. To ensure the Labrador Retriever is getting adequate nutrition, owners may want to supplement its diet with probiotics, glucosamine, and omega fatty acids.
Yes, Labrador Retrievers do have special requirements. They are an active breed and require plenty of exercise to stay healthy and happy. It is important that they get at least one hour of exercise per day. They also need to be mentally stimulated with activities such as training and games, as well as socialization with other animals and people. Labrador Retrievers should also be groomed regularly to keep their coats healthy and free of tangles. Additionally, it is important to monitor a Labrador Retriever's diet and keep them on a consistent, nutritious diet.
Labrador Retrievers are a large breed, typically ranging in size from 22 to 24 inches in height and weighing between 55 to 80 pounds. Generally speaking they tend to be a bit longer than tall but these are only generalizations. There are always exceptions to the rule. Though the majority of Labradors will fall into the weight and height range mentioned above, there is always the potential for the breed to be larger or smaller. Moreover, daily exercise not only promotes good physical health, it can also affect the size of the dog.
Labrador Retrievers have a deep love of swimming and have a natural affinity for it. This is due to their working-dog heritage and the fact that the Labrador Retriever breed was developed to be an excellent breed for retrieving waterfowl. Thanks to this, and their muscular body type, people often find that most Labradors are keen swimmers. Their powerful backstroke, which allows them to swim effortlessly for long distances, also makes swimming a fun and rewarding activity for them. Some Labradors even love to take part in water agility and obedience activities.
Labrador Retrievers are excellent companions for kids, due to their friendly, gentle nature. They are well-known for having an even temperament and lots of patience, so they make great playmates for children of all ages. Furthermore, thanks to their intelligence and their eagerness to please their owners, Labradors are easily trained, making them even more enjoyable and safe for children. On top of that, since Labradors have a strong affinity for people, they form strong bonds with kids and their family, further strengthening the positive relationship they can have with children.
Training a Labrador Retriever can be easy depending on the individual and the approach adopted by the owner. Labradors are social and smart dogs that are eager to please, which makes them highly receptive to training. If owners understand their pup's behaviors, temperament, and needs, it can be relatively straightforward to teach them basic commands. Good reinforcement methods are important to ensure that their Labrador associates good behavior with rewards or praise. Patience and consistency in training is essential, and rewarding good behavior regularly will help to reinforce the behavior.
